Bioshield Clay paint was designed for either new drywall or over existing paint. Two coats are recommended. Clay paint can be applied over wood provided that the wood is clean, dry and not not oily like teak. We recommend priming the wood first with either AFM Transitional Primer or ECOS Wood Primer.Clay Paint is not suited for frequent cleaning. Grease and other contaminants may remain embedded in the paint. For extra protection in high-impact areas such as hallways and kitchens, we recommend using BioShield Wall Glaze #15: sprayed, sponged, or otherwise applied (not rolled!) over a Clay Paint surface. For bathrooms Clay Paint can only be used in low-impact areas and areas that do not receive regular water exposure (such as around showers and sinks.) In normal living environments, Clay Paints have moisture regulating and odor reducing properties and they provide optimum breathability.Clay Paints are low-odor, non-toxic, no-VOC.Coverage: 300-400 square feet per gallon, depending upon surface texture, porosity and method of application.
